On 10/22/12 15:51, Peter Maydell wrote:
> On 22 October 2012 14:28, Gerd Hoffmann <kraxel@redhat.com> wrote:
>> Commit 585f60368f23e6603cf86cfdaeceb89d1169f4b8 appearently breaks the
>> libvirt feature detection, my guests fail to start with this message:
>>
>> error: Failed to start domain fedora-org-virtio
>> error: internal error qemu does not support SGA
>>
>> Running libvirt-0.10.2-2.el6.x86_64
> 
> Yeah, this is the commit that means you need an updated libvirt
> from this point on (and in particular for qemu-1.3).

Well, only problem is that 0.10.2 already is the latest libvirt release.
 Was it really intentional to break things like this?
